On Thu, 16 Dec 2004, Marc Perkel wrote:

> Yes - but - Exim does allow the HELO to not be a DNS name at all


It allows an IP address in [] as per the RFC.

> and it allows that there might not be a HELO at all. So I think it's
> is at least inconsistent with other loose rules regarding HELO.


I can consistently claim that I am as inconsistent as anybody else. :-)

> Quite frankly - I'm not sure that the HELO has any useful
> functionality in the first place and I wonder why it even exists.


EHLO (as opposed to HELO) enables the client to discover what optional
SMTP facilities the server supports.
